Firstsource’s inch-wide, mile-deep practitioners work collaboratively, leveraging UnBPO™ - their differentiated approach to reimagining traditional outsourcing - to deliver real-world, future-focused solutions that drive speed, scale, and smarter decision, turning transformation into tangible results for clients.Job location :Bangalore Position : Compliance Analyst-US Mortgage Process: US Residential MortgageThe Compliance Underwriter is responsible for performing compliance reviews within the TRID 3.0 and TRID 1.0 scopes to ensure federal and state regulatory requirements and guidelines are met. This role owns end-to-end compliance reviews of mortgage loan files. Responsible for compliance underwriting, due diligence, portfolio analysis, and compliance review projects.Primary Responsibilities Review and capturing loan data from mortgage documents including but not limited to Mortgage/Deed of Trust, Note, Right of Rescission, Loan Estimate, Closing Disclosure, Good Faith Estimate, 1003, Disclosures, etc. Extensive knowledge of TRID, TILA, RESPA, ECOA, HMDA, HOEPA, ATR/QM, State-specificregulations (high-cost, high-price, licensing, disclosures) Review HUD-1, Closing Disclosures, Loan Estimates, TIL and other mortgage disclosures for completeness and accuracy Analyzing and capturing settlement fees for state and federal testing Identifying potential problems within the underwriting administrative process and identifying compliance irregularities within the loan file Manage individual workflow to ensure daily volume and quality goals are met Evaluating the disclosure process including but not limited to the delivery, timing, required verbiage, execution and completeness of all State and Federal documentation.
